OSX 相当于 ShellExecute?
我有一个 C++ 应用程序,正在从 Win32 移植到 OSX。 我希望能够启动任意文件,就像用户打开它们一样。 在 Windows 上使用 ShellExecute 这很容易。 如…
如何shell到另一个应用程序并让它以delphi形式出现
在 Delphi 中,我多年来一直使用 ShellExecute 来启动(并可选择等待)其他应用程序。 但现在,我需要让这些应用程序之一出现在我的 Delphi 应用程序…
在新的浏览器进程中打开 URL
我需要在新的浏览器进程中打开 URL。 当浏览器进程退出时我需要收到通知。 我当前使用的代码如下: Process browser = new Process() browser.EnableR…
从过程中执行 ShellExecute
我想称呼这个..以及好 ShellExecute(Handle, 'open', 'c:\Windows\notepad.exe', nil, nil, SW_SHOWNORMAL) 我可以从 form1 的方法中毫无问题地调用它…
从 WOW64 启动 Shell 链接 (LNK)
我们的 32 位应用程序通过 ShellExecute 启动 Windows LNK 文件(Shell 链接)。 当它尝试“启动”到 64 位二进制文件的链接(例如“开始”菜单中…
.NET 中的 ShellExecute 等效项
我正在寻找 .NET 首选的方法来执行 ShellExecute 在 Win32 中执行的相同类型的操作(对任意文件类型打开、打印等)。 我从事 Windows 编程已有 20 多…
如何从 Python 执行程序? os.system 由于路径中存在空格而失败
我有一个Python脚本需要执行外部程序,但由于某种原因失败了。 如果我有以下脚本: import os os.system("C:\\Temp\\a b c\\Notepad.exe") raw_input(…
摆脱 ShellExecute 造成的邪恶延迟
这是困扰我一段时间的事情,必须有一个解决方案。 每次我调用 ShellExecute 打开外部文件(无论是文档、可执行文件还是 URL)时,这都会导致我的程序…
Vista 不允许一个 .exe 调用另一个 .exe
我有一个在 Vista 上运行的旧版 VB6 可执行文件。 此可执行文件将另一个旧版 MFC C++ 可执行文件脱壳。 在我们早期的 Vista 测试中,此调用将显示典型…
Google Chrome 破坏了 ShellExecute()?
多年来,我一直使用 ShellExecute() API 从我的应用程序中启动默认的 Web 浏览器。 就像这样: ShellExecute( hwnd, _T("open"), _T("http://www.wina…